Thanks for taking the time to visit my JustGiving page.

From October 26th to 1st November 2013 I will be taking part in the Hexham and Necastle Diocesan pilgrimage to Santiago de Compostella. Starting in the town of Sarria, we will cover just over 63 miles over 5 days. As well as asking for your prayers, especially for my feet, I am also looking to raise some funds, split 50/50 between two good causes. These are for Fr. Sarves work in India and for SANDS, the UK stillbirth and neonatal death charity that supports anyone affected by the death of a baby and promotes research to reduce the loss of babies’ lives. I have set up individual Just Giving pages each charity.  It would be nice if any support you might give is split equally but that is a matter of choice for you.  Every bit of help we give to any good cause is always welcomed.
